The impact of survivorship care on burden of disease among Hodgkin lymphoma survivors.

Structured follow-up care for Hodgkin lymphoma survivors reduces burden from late treatment side effects and improves quality of life.

This multi-center study from the Netherlands evaluated the effect of survivorship care programs on long-term morbidity and quality of life in Hodgkin lymphoma survivors. Findings provide evidence supporting the integration of survivorship care pathways for this population at high risk of late treatment effects.
